A train trip from East Midlands Parkway to Bellingham takes about 2hrs 46 mins on average, covering roughly 112 miles (180 kilometres). With around 23 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£17.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Set in the heart of the East Midlands, East Midlands Parkway Train Station is a prime connectivity point for travelers exploring the region or beyond. Opened in 2009, this station serves as a contemporary gateway, seamlessly linking passengers to key destinations with ease. East Midlands Parkway Station provides a range of amenities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. You will find ticket buying facilities readily available, with a ticket office open from early morning until evening. For those who prefer booking online, tickets can be conveniently collected from the machines at the station. Accessibility is a strong focus here; the station proudly boasts step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. With tactile paving and accessible seating, every traveler's needs are considered.
The station is also equipped with modern facilities. While there are no shops available, you can grab a quick bite at the on-site café. Keep in mind there's no ATM, so you might want to come prepared with cash.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ected while you wait for your train.
Navigating your way to and from East Midlands Parkway is a breeze thanks to its strategic transport links. The station offers extensive parking facilities with 885 spaces available, including 22 dedicated for accessible parking. It offers affordable daily and long-term rates, making driving to the station a practical option. If you prefer public transport, there's a Rail Replacement Service right at the front of the station and buses are easily accessible for continued journeys to surrounding areas. Taxis are also on hand, with firms like AJ Cars readily available.
Even though there are no cycle hire services at the station, bike storage is available with secure and sheltered stands right at the entrance.

Located in the southeastern part of London, Bellingham Train Station is a noteworthy hub for local travelers and daily commuters alike. With its strategic position on the bustling Thameslink network, it offers seamless connections to a multitude of destinations. Bellingham Station is equipped to facilitate easy ticket purchases with its ticket office open from Monday to Friday between 06:10 and 19:30, and on weekends with reduced hours. You’ll find ticket machines that also accommodate those travelers with a Disabled Persons Railcard. There's a seamless provision for collecting tickets bought online, ensuring that your travel plans remain uninterrupted. Expect to find all crucial customer information displayed on screens accompanied by regular announcements.
While Bellingham does well in terms of its ticketing services, the station sacrifices some amenities in other areas. It lacks step-free access, which may pose challenges for those with mobility issues—though assistance can be readily arranged through staffed help points. Security measures include CCTV coverage, providing peace of mind for those using the bicycle storage facilities or waiting for trains.
For rail travelers excited to explore beyond the station confines, Bellingham connects efficiently with other travel modes. Despite the absence of accessible taxis and car park provisions, plenty of local bus services are accessible from the station vicinity. A detailed 'Onward Travel Information Map' is available on-site to aid in planning the next leg of your journey. During disturbances or planned works, detailed information regarding rail replacement services is also accessible.
